Fresh looks at fashion from UW-Stout’s apparel design and development students will be on the runway during the Wear Fashion Show at 7 p.m. Thursday, April 20, and 4 p.m. Saturday, April 22, in the Great Hall of the Memorial Student Center.

Admission is free. Following Saturday’s show will be prizes and raffles.

Previously known as Silhouettes, the annual show features dozens of designs for men, women and children created by students. The designs of 30 students will be featured.

The show is sponsored by the new student Wear Fashion Association, which has created a new runway to bring the audience closer to the garments.

The show coordinator is Alyssa Lostetter, of Waconia, Minn., a senior majoring in apparel design and development and also in retail merchandising and management. She is Wear president.
